Facility Evaluation Report
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Elecia Weathersby conducted an in person announced visit to the facility for purpose of a Pre-Licensing evaluation. An initial application to operate an Adult Residential Facility was submitted to the Central Applications Unit (CAU) for a total capacity of 4 ambulatory residents and 0 bedridden residents. Fire Clearance was granted 07/19/2021. LPA Weathersby observed the following:
No residents currently occupy the property. Licensee currently occupies property.
Structure: Facility was a single-story house with four (4) resident bedrooms with an on suite half bath (Walk in shower only), and one other resident bathroom (Full), living room, dining area, and kitchen area.
Heating/Cooling System: Central heating and air conditioning systems, set at 73 degrees upon inspection.
Bedrooms: Each resident bedroom will accommodate 1 ambulatory client. All bedrooms were adequately furnished with bed, chair, closets, appropriate linens, adequate lighting, and an operational smoke alarm.
Bathrooms: Bathrooms have a working toilet, wash basin, and shower with an adequate supply of toilet paper, paper towels and toiletries. Water temperature measured by LPA Weathersby read between 105 F and 120 F.
Kitchen/Laundry: An adequate supply of dishes, glasses, utensils, were observed. Cleaning supplies and knives/sharp instruments were secured in a locked cabinet and drawer. There was adequate room for food storage. Refrigerator/freezer were in working condition and had sufficient storage for perishable food. There was adequate seating for meals.
Living/Family room: Furnished with safe and adequate seating and furnishings. All items appear to be in good repair.
Linens and Hygiene Supplies: An adequate supply of hygiene supplies noted.
